14 articles · Updated · Reuters · May 27
  • MSCI’s Asia-Pacific ex-Japan index rose 1.6% to a record high, while Japan’s Nikkei briefly topped 66,000 and South Korea’s KOSPI surged 3.41%.
  • AI-driven risk appetite from fresh U.S. stock-market highs combined with hopes a shaky U.S.-Iran ceasefire will hold, though traders said much of the good news is already priced in.
  • Samsung’s wage deal helped lift Seoul shares by averting a strike that threatened global chip supplies, while U.S. crude still held near $92.04 and Brent near $98.07 after the prior day’s spike.
  • The kiwi jumped 0.7% to $0.5878 after the RBNZ held rates at 2.25% in a split decision and signaled hikes may need to come sooner.
  • Iran accused Washington of violating the ceasefire, Rubio said a broader deal could take days, and investors now turn to U.S. PCE data and central-bank signals on whether the energy shock will fuel inflation.

Record Highs for Asian Stocks in May 2026: Tech Surge, Oil Shocks, and Geopolitical Risks

Overview

In late May 2026, Asian stock markets surged to record highs, led by Japanese and Chinese equities. This rally was fueled by a clear recovery in risk appetite across the Asia-Pacific, driven by robust demand in the AI and semiconductor cycle, strong performance in technology sectors, and a sense of geopolitical relief. Positive expectations around oil prices also supported market sentiment. Notably, China’s A-share market and companies like SMIC reached new highs, highlighting the region’s strength in semiconductors. Together, these factors created an optimistic yet cautious investment environment across Asia.
